Product Type Two-Way Radio (UHF CB)
Brand Oricom
Model UHF2390
Frequency Range UHF 476.425 – 477.4125 MHz (CB band)
Channels 80 channels (including 8 repeater channels)
Output Power 5 Watts (maximum allowed)
Power Source Rechargeable Ni-MH battery pack or 3 x AAA alkaline batteries
Battery Life Up to 16 hours (typical use)
Range Up to 10 km (line of sight), typically 2-5 km in urban areas
Display LCD with backlight
Keypad Full numeric keypad with dedicated function buttons
CTCSS/DCS Built-in 50 CTCSS tones and 104 DCS codes
VOX Voice-activated transmission (hands-free)
Scanning Channel scan and priority scan
Waterproof Rating IP54 (splash-proof and dust resistant)
Dimensions (H x W x D) 165 x 60 x 35 mm
Weight (with battery) Approx. 250 g
Charging Time Approx. 14 hours for battery pack
Accessories Included Rechargeable battery pack, desktop charger, belt clip, wrist strap, manual
Operating Temperature -10°C to 60°C
Warranty 2 years (depending on region)

Frequently Asked Questions - UHF2390 Oricom

How do I charge the UHF2390?
Place the radio into the desktop charger with the battery pack installed. Connect the charger to a wall outlet. The red LED will indicate charging; it turns green when fully charged. Charging time is approximately 14 hours.
What is the maximum range of this radio?
The UHF2390 has a maximum range of up to 10 km in line-of-sight conditions. In urban or wooded areas, range is typically reduced to 2-5 km.
How many channels does it have?
It features 80 channels, including 8 repeater channels. You can access all channels via the numeric keypad.
Is the radio waterproof?
It has an IP54 rating, meaning it is splash-proof and dust-resistant. It should not be submerged in water.
Can I use rechargeable batteries?
Yes, it comes with a rechargeable Ni-MH battery pack. Alternatively, you can use 3 x AAA alkaline batteries (not included) for backup.
What is VOX and how do I use it?
VOX (Voice Operated Exchange) allows hands-free transmission. Press the Menu button, select VOX, and choose a sensitivity level (1-5). When you speak into the microphone, the radio will transmit automatically.
How do I set privacy codes (CTCSS/DCS)?
Press Menu until the code setting appears. Use the up/down buttons to select a CTCSS tone or DCS code. Confirm with Menu. Both radios must use the same code to communicate privately.
Why is the battery not charging?
Ensure the battery pack is properly inserted and the charger is connected to power. If the LED doesn't light, check the contacts for dirt. If issues persist, try a different power outlet.
Can I use the radio while charging?
Yes, you can operate the radio while it is in the charger, but charging may stop temporarily during transmission due to power draw.
How do I perform a factory reset?
Turn off the radio. Press and hold the Menu and Scan buttons simultaneously, then turn on the radio. Release the buttons when the display shows 'RESET'.
